As for Gormenghast, my husband and I own the trilogy in one mammoth book.  I'm enjoying it, but it's awfully preponderous and slow-going.  Mervyn Peake, the author, was *extremely* descriptive and will use an entire chapter describing a room that a scene will take place in before the actual chapter containing the scene!
